I first met these guys at the chili fest at Colasantis earlier in the year. I was there twice this week and the food is fantastic. My son and I went for the steak tartare. I've had this dish in France and this one definitely matches it in all aspects. I've had the potato bacon soup which is spectacular. Tonight I had the steak tartare again and it was presented and tasted the same as the first time. I also had the burger, cooked medium rare which is unheard of in Canada. The combination of bacon, and Gouda cheese was very well balanced and flavourful. The fries and gravy on the side were also well done. I highly recommend this establishment. Oh, try the beer, top shelf!

My wife and I had dinner here on Thursday, November 23. I started with a beer flight. 3 out of the 4 beers that I tried were good, however one of them had a very strong taste of cloves, which was very overpowering. I couldn’t even finish it. Now while we’re on the subject of cloves, let’s talk about the venison rack. First off, I am a huge fan of venison and when I saw it on the menu online I already knew that’s what I’d order for dinner. Huge mistake! Number one: For $42 I thought I’d get more than two medium sized chops; Number two: The sauce that was on them was overpowering with cloves. I’m not a fan of cloves, so needless to say I did not enjoy the venison. I only ate one of the chops and took the other one back to our Airbnb to see if I could salvage it at all. The garlic mashed potatoes were disappointing as well. No flavor whatsoever. No garlic, no salt and no pepper. Bland! I informed the waitress of these issues with the food and asked her if she could relay these issues to the chef. I have no idea if she did or not because she said nothing to me after taking my plate to the kitchen. Now on the positive side, my wife’s salmon was very good. Even the vegetables that came with it were quite tasty. With that being said, it would have been nice to hear something from the chef regarding the issues I had with the food, but if the waitress did not say anything, how would he know. Unfortunately I’d be hard pressed to come back here. Definitely not worth the money for what I got and the lack of caring about a customer’s concerns make it difficult for me to recommend this place. Also, the beers on the flight were not even labeled. Had to ask for water as well. Service was subpar for there only being three tables included ours. The reason you get two stars instead of one is because of the meal my wife got and that’s the only reason!

I just had one of the best sandwiches of my life! The chicken brie club was transcendental. I had the stuffed red pepper soup as a side which was excellent as well. But, man, that sandwich was spellbinding. There was no line defining where the melted brie stopped and the mayo started. The chicken was sliced thin, blackened and still tender. The bacon was devine. The bun: perfectly toasted. The apple slices were pickled, and somehow soft and crispy at the same time. Honestly, I just enjoyed the smell of the sandwich for a few minutes before tucking in. Gratitude to the master of this work.
